Crispy Buttermilk Air-Fried Chicken
Enjoy a perfectly crispy yet tender chicken dish that’s air-fried to golden perfection. The tangy buttermilk marinade enhances the natural flavor of the chicken, while a light almond flour coating delivers a satisfying crunch without deep frying. A healthier twist on a classic favorite, ideal for any meal of the day.
INGREDIENTS
6 oz Chicken Breast
1/4 cup Low-Fat Buttermilk
1/4 cup Almond Flour
1 tsp Garlic Powder
1 tsp Paprika
Pinch of Salt
Pinch of Black Pepper
PREPARATION
Start by placing the chicken breast in a shallow dish. Pour the low-fat buttermilk over the chicken and sprinkle with half of the garlic powder, paprika, salt, and black pepper. Let it marinate for at least 30 minutes in the refrigerator.
Meanwhile, prepare the coating by placing the almond flour in a separate shallow dish. Add the remaining garlic powder, paprika, salt, and black pepper to the almond flour and mix well.
After marinating, remove the chicken from the buttermilk, allowing any excess liquid to drip off. Dredge the chicken in the seasoned almond flour, ensuring an even coating on all sides.
Preheat your air fryer to 400°F. Lightly spray the air fryer basket with a bit of cooking spray to prevent sticking.
Place the coated chicken in the air fryer basket and cook for approximately 12-15 minutes, flipping once halfway through, until the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F and the coating is crispy and golden.
Remove the chicken from the air fryer and let it rest for a few minutes before serving. Enjoy your crispy, flavorful air-fried chicken!
